What happens during a Puppies & Yoga session in Scottsdale

The experience is intentionally simple: you move, you breathe, you laugh, you cuddle puppies. Here’s the basic flow of the 75 minutes.

1) Arrive and settle in (plan to be early)

Participants are asked to arrive 15 minutes early for a smooth start. This extra time helps you check in, get comfortable in the space, and get set up on your mat.

To keep the session on track, entry is not allowed 20 minutes after the session begins. If you’re coming from across town, build in buffer time for parking and traffic so you can start relaxed, not rushed.

2) 45-minute all-level flow yoga (with puppies in the room)

The yoga portion is a 45-minute all-level flow. “All-level” typically means you can modify postures based on your comfort and ability, making it a welcoming option for first-timers and regular yogis alike.

And yes, the puppies are part of the environment during the flow. They may roam, rest nearby, or curiously explore the studio. It’s a different vibe than a silent studio class, in the best possible way.

3) 30-minute “puppy chill” time

After the flow, the session transitions into 30 minutes of puppy chill, which is dedicated time for gentle interaction, cuddles, photos, and play. This portion is a highlight for many participants because it’s unhurried, social, and pure serotonin.

One important note: because puppy wellness comes first, interaction is not guaranteed. Puppies may choose to nap or keep to themselves, and staff may guide interactions to keep everything calm and safe.

Meet the puppies: where they come from and how wellness is protected

A major reason puppy yoga can feel so meaningful is that it’s not only fun for humans. When done thoughtfully, it can also support puppies during an important developmental window.

Local sourcing and puppy age

Puppies are sourced from local breeders. The puppies participating in class are typically:

  • 8 to 12 weeks old
  • Vaccinated
  • Kept with their litter and not mixed with other litters

Keeping puppies with their litter and avoiding mixing can reduce stress and help maintain a consistent, safer environment for young dogs.

Why puppy yoga can support socialization

These sessions are designed to promote gentle human interaction for puppies before they are rehomed. Calm, positive experiences with people can help puppies feel more comfortable as they transition to new families.

How many puppies will be there?

Each session typically hosts 6 to 12 puppies, though the exact number may vary depending on the litter size and availability.

Breed announcements (and why they can change)

Puppy breeds are often announced a few days in advance on social media and may also appear on the booking page. Because these are live animals with real needs, breeds are not guaranteed and can vary at the last minute for a range of reasons.
